Soroban Capital Partners LP trimmed its holdings in Entergy Corporation (NYSE:ETR – Free Report) by 46.5% during the first qu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 1,723,304 shares of the utilities provider’s stock after selling 1,499,230 shares during the period. Entergy makes up approximately 0.4% of Soroban Capital Partners LP’s holdings, making the stock its 19th largest holding. Soroban Capital Partners LP’s holdings in Entergy were worth $193,630,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Entergy Company Profile
Entergy Corporation (NYSE:ETR) is an integrated energy company headquartered in New Orleans, Louisiana, that generates, transmits and distributes electricity. The company’s operations combine regulated utility services with competitive power production, supplying retail electricity to residential, commercial and industrial customers while also participating in wholesale energy markets. Entergy’s generation fleet includes nuclear, natural gas, hydropower and other resources, and it operates a network of transmission and distribution assets to deliver power to end users.
Entergy conducts its regulated utility business through state-based operating subsidiaries that serve customers across parts of Arkansas, Louisiana, Mississippi and southeast Texas.
